Analysis
In 2024, share of electricity generation from solar and wind in Myanmar stood at 0.6%.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 6.0% on the previous year and up 695.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, share of electricity generation from solar and wind in Myanmar peaked at 0.7% in 2022 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 2000.
Myanmar ranks 158th of 211 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
